About Joe Reynolds

Joe Reynolds is a scholar working on Small Animals, Health, Toxicology and Mutagenesis and Dermatology, having authored 13 papers that have together received 185 indexed citations. Recurring topics across this work include Animal testing and alternatives (7 papers), Computational Drug Discovery Methods (5 papers) and Effects and risks of endocrine disrupting chemicals (4 papers). The work is most often cited by research in Chemical Health and Safety (10 citations), Small Animals (77 citations) and Health, Toxicology and Mutagenesis (56 citations). Joe Reynolds has collaborated with scholars based in United Kingdom, United States and Italy. Frequent co-authors include Andrew White, Hequn Li, Maria Teresa Baltazar, Matthew Dent, Paul L. Carmichael, Sophie Malcomber, A. Middleton, N. Gilmour, Paul Walker and Gavin Maxwell. Their work appears in journals such as SHILAP Revista de lepidopterología, Toxicology and Applied Pharmacology and Toxicological Sciences.
